"he Hyatt Regency Lake Tahoe is everything you dream a mountain-lake getaway could be — and then some. From the moment we pulled up, the scent of pine, the crisp mountain air, and the warm welcome from the staff set the tone for an unforgettable stay.
The location is unbeatable. Nestled right on the shore of Lake Tahoe, the property feels like its own private retreat while still being just minutes from Incline Village. You can walk from your room to the sand in under a minute, coffee in hand, and watch the sunrise paint the water in colors you didn’t think existed.
Our room was spacious, immaculate, and designed with understated luxury — plush bedding, a fireplace, and a balcony view that could have been a postcard. Every detail felt intentional, from the cozy robes to the in-room coffee setup.
The dining is fantastic, with Lone Eagle Grille standing out as a must-visit — a warm, lodge-style restaurant with floor-to-ceiling lake views and a menu that’s equal parts creative and comforting. Evenings by the massive outdoor fire pit, cocktail in hand, were pure bliss.
The resort amenities make it easy to never leave: a serene spa, an inviting pool and hot tubs, and a private beach with lounge chairs and cabanas. The staff is what truly elevates the experience — friendly, proactive, and clearly proud to be part of the Hyatt Tahoe family.
This isn’t just a place to stay; it’s a place to slow down, breathe deeply, and soak in the magic of Lake Tahoe."
